HOW TO MANAGE MULTIPLE CREDIT CARDS: ALL YOU NEED TO KNOW

The credit card has become popular due to the convenience offered by it. It’s a type of unsecured borrowing that lets you borrow according to your pre-decided credit limit under a bank or non-banking finance company (NBFC). You can make transactions with your credit card for various transactions as per your credit limit and then pay it back in due time. When you make a purchase, the amount is deducted from your predefined credit limit and when you repay, the amount is again added back to your credit limit. This enables you to have continuous access to credit as long as you are using less than your credit limit. However, if you do not repay the due amounts on time the bank will charge interest on the outstanding amount and this will keep adding up until you have cleared your bills. You can make transactions as per your credit limit, beyond that the transaction will be rejected by the credit card issuer. Various types are credit cards are available to meet the needs of customers ranging from student credit cards to lifestyle credit cards.

10 WAYS TO RE-BUILDING YOUR CREDIT SCORE AFTER LOAN SETTLEMENT

Loan settlement is an agreement between the borrower and the lender where the borrower repays a portion of the debt to the lender which is usually less than the outstanding amount as a final settlement. 

Usually, during times of financial hardships such as medical emergencies, job loss, or some other unforeseen events, the borrower is not in the capacity to repay the loan, and depending on the genuineness of the reason the lender can forgive some amount of debt. When the lender pays the agreed amount, the loan is marked as “settled”. 

Loan settlement can help the borrower to reach financial steadiness. By doing loan settlement, the borrower can eliminate a financial obligation which will help him to reallocate his funds to other important aspects like savings, emergency funds, investment, etc.

How to Improve CIBIL Score After Loan Settlement 

Loan settlement is the process of settling an outstanding loan by having an agreement between the lender and the borrower. It is sometimes referred to as debt negotiation, debt relief, or debt resolution. A loan settlement is essentially an agreement between you and your lender to repay your debt for a sum that is lower than what you owe. A number of factors, including business losses, incapacity, job losses, or financial troubles, may cause borrowers to be unable to make their monthly payments. You have the option to settle your loan in the event that any of these circumstances arise. But not every borrower qualifies for this lump sum loan settlement.
